Health1 month ago
Startling News: Turks and Caicos Records July COVID-19 Death as Regular Tracking Resumes & global cases up 11%
Deandrea Hamilton | Editor Turks and Caicos, August 15, 2025 – Startling news for the Turks and Caicos Islands as health officials confirm a new...